Interesting note on USC 247 about Mark Bowman (5* TE), w/ a bunch of quotes from him re: USC.  (USC posters keep asking when he's going to commit, and treat him as a silent commit.)

The 247 writer uses terms such as uncertainly and skepticism to describe Bowman's view of the TE position/production under Riley, at USC.  Riley and Savage (USC TE coach) are trying to use Mark Andrews (Oklahoma) as a comp.. Bowman says - in so many words - that he needs to see it on the field, this season, and he's holding off on making a decision until he sees how that goes.

FWIW - and it may not matter to Bowman - Wiltfong CBed Luke Sorensen (another TE out of Cal) to them last month.

Endries, Washington, Shannon ... Townsend ... 🙏  🙏  🙏.
